D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
Performs scheduled and emergency maintenance on manufacturing machinery and facilities. Corrects problems with hydraulic, pneumatic, electrical, as well as PLC's. Maintains specified production and spare equipment. Performs basic to moderately complex mechanical repairs and installations. Performs basic to moderately complex grounds/facilities repairs, as required. Interacts with vendors to complete projects or to repair equipment
- Diagnose root cause of problem and correct issues with mechanical, electrical, hydraulic, and pneumatic machinery and equipment
- Perform routine, predictive, and preventive maintenance on all machinery
- Operate man lifts and forklifts, transport heavy parts and equipment, and complete forklift safety training
- Identify needed parts to repair facilities and machinery necessary to insure continuous production
- Initiate and complete CMMS work orders utilizing Maintenance Connection
- Coordinate maintenance of parts inventory with MRO and purchasing personnel
- Maintain grinders and associated blowers; adjust and install sharpened blades
- Fabricate metal parts (e.g. brackets); perform welding as required
- Perform basic to moderately complex electrical repairs and installations of AC/DC drives, HMI screens and high horsepower motors
